Patent number: 10595375Abstract: The invention provides a lighting system comprising one or more solid state light sources, wherein the lighting system is configured to provide lighting system light having a correlated color temperature of at least 1700 K and having a S* value of at least 33 in a first setting of the lighting system, wherein the S* value is defined as S*=100*(2*A*+B*)/WS with A* being the spectral power in the wavelength range of 380-440 nm, B* being the spectral power in the wavelength range of 660-780 nm, and Ws being the total spectral power in the wavelength range of 380-780 nm of the lighting system light.Type: GrantFiled: December 21, 2017Date of Patent: March 17, 2020Assignee: SIGNIFY HOLDING B.V.Inventors: Marcus Theodorus Maria Lambooij, Dragan Sekulovski, Tobias Borra, Petrus Johannes Hendrikus Seuntiens, Martinus Petrus Joseph Peeters, Lucas Josef Maria Schlangen

Patent number: 10467670Abstract: The present invention relates to assisting a user in selecting a lighting device design by providing a lighting device design based on a model or image of a lighting device design (e.g. the user uploading an image of an existing lighting device in his/her home). The lighting device design of the model or image is analyzed in order to determine a lighting device design related variable (e.g. type, shape or color of lighting device design). This variable is then used to select a lighting device design from a set of lighting device designs (e.g. to select a lighting device design of the same color, from an electronic catalogue of lighting device designs); or to generate a lighting device design (e.g. to generate a lighting device design that is a copy of the lighting device design in the image, only smaller and in a different color). The invention further includes a system and computer program product for implementation of this method.Type: GrantFiled: October 24, 2013Date of Patent: November 5, 2019Assignee: SIGNIFY HOLDNG B.V.Inventors: Petrus Johannes Hendrikus Seuntiens, Bram Knaapen, Bartel Marinus Van De Sluis, Chris Damkat, Anthonie Hendrik Bergman, Wei Pien Lee, Tim Dekker, Stefan Donivan Twigt, Robertus Antonius Jacobus Maria Hovers, Bertrand Rigot

Patent number: 9822950Abstract: A lighting system comprises a light source having an exit window and an electrically controllable light processing arrangement, in the form of a grid of cells lying in a plane parallel to the exit window. Each cell has a cell wall formed as electrically switchable element which is switchable between at least two processing modes. The cell wall surrounds an opening, such that light emitted in a normal direction from the light source exit window is not processed, and light passing at an angle to the normal direction greater than a threshold angle is processed by the cell wall for color and/or intensity control.Type: GrantFiled: December 19, 2014Date of Patent: November 21, 2017Assignee: PHILIPS LIGHTING HOLDING B.V.Inventors: Berent Willem Meerbeek, Kars-Michiel Hubert Lenssen, Petrus Johannes Hendrikus Seuntiens, Johannes Petrus Wilhelmus Baaijens, Jochen Renaat Van Gheluwe, Bart Kroon, Evert Jan Van Loenen, Philip Steven Newton, Ramon Antoine Wiro Clout

Patent number: 9668312Abstract: A lighting system uses an array of lighting elements which provide light in different directions. The intensity of the lighting elements is controlled in dependence on a time-varying parameter related to at least one of a position of a light emitting or light reflecting body, and an intensity, color or color temperature of the light emitted or reflected by the body, such that the system can simulate directional sunlight.Type: GrantFiled: September 25, 2014Date of Patent: May 30, 2017Assignee: PHILIPS LIGHTING HOLDING B.V.Inventors: Berent Willem Meerbeek, Jochen Renaat Van Gheluwe, Jacobus Dingenis Machiel Van Boven, Petrus Johannes Hendrikus Seuntiens, Evert Jan Van Loenen

Patent number: 9488327Abstract: A lighting system has a recessed panel (light source or window) and a side wall or a set of side walls around the recess. The side wall (or at least one of the side walls), is provided with a lighting arrangement for controlling the color of illumination and/or shape from which light is emitted from the side wall or side walls. This can be used to replicate the sharp lighting boundaries that arise on the recess walls from sun illumination through a skylight, or else they can be used to provide general illumination around a window.Type: GrantFiled: October 1, 2014Date of Patent: November 8, 2016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Jochen Renaat Van Gheluwe, Berent Willem Meerbeek, Petrus Johannes Hendrikus Seuntiens, Jacobus Dingenis Machiel Van Boven, Evert Jan Van Loenen

Patent number: 9476567Abstract: An optical element, a lighting system and a luminaire is provided. The optical element comprises a plate 100 and a plurality of collimating means. The optical element is to be used in front of a light source comprising a light emitting surface 106, and the optical element is configured to obtain a skylight appearance. The plate 100 is to be arranged parallel to the light emitting surface 106. The plate 100 is opaque and comprises a plurality of holes 104. The plate 100 further comprises a reflective surface 102 which is to be arranged parallel to the light emitting surface 106. The reflective surface 102 is light reflective in a predetermined spectral range to obtain a blue light emission 100. The plurality of collimating means collimate a part of the light received from the light source to obtain a collimated light beam 112 in a specific direction. Each one of the collimating means comprises one of the plurality of holes of the plate 104.Type: GrantFiled: July 19, 2012Date of Patent: October 25, 2016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Petrus Johannes Hendrikus Seuntiens, Bart Andre Salters, Gabriel-Eugen Onac, Berent Willem Meerbeek, Evert Jan Van Loenen

Publication number: 20110221963Abstract: A display system having 3D ambient light functionality is provided. The system comprises at least light source for providing ambient light having color and/or intensity dependent on the image content. The system comprises a control unit configured to control the color and intensity of light emitted from each light source to produce a 3D-viewing sensation, at least partly based on depth information.Type: ApplicationFiled: November 24, 2009Publication date: September 15, 2011Applicant: KONINKLIJKE PHILIPS ELECTRONICS N.V.Inventors: Filip Marcel Denise Bruyneel, Christophe Hoebeeck, Dirck Seynaeve, Alfred Peeters, Petrus Johannes Hendrikus Seuntiens, Michael Verberne, Fei Zuo, Willem Franciscus Johannes Hoogenstraaten, Cornelis Wilhelmus Kwisthout

Publication number: 20100002079Abstract: A display system, comprises a multi-view display panel (10) adapted to display different images to different viewers in different directions. Imaging means (16) monitors viewers within a field of view and the display output is varied in dependence on the monitoring information provided by the imaging means. The invention thus provides a display display system which captures viewer information and uses this to control the display of multiple images at appropriate respective viewing angles. This enables information to be tailored to a particular viewer's characteristics or enables a user to be tracked as they move. Thus, different viewers can have personalised information when watching different views of the same display. This provides a dynamic view allocation system.Type: ApplicationFiled: June 14, 2007Publication date: January 7, 2010Applicant: KONINKLIJKE PHILIPS ELECTRONICS N.V.Inventors: Marcellinus Petrus Carolus Michael Krijn, Oscar Hendrikus Willemsen, Remco Theodorus Johannes Muijs, Petrus Johannes Hendrikus Seuntiens
